C#winform怎么把特殊符号显示出来

在winform开辟过程中,有时为了让资料看起来加倍的直不雅好理解,就需要插手一些特别字符,例如直径符号 φ 。而这个符号直接写在代码或者任何一个文本框中,都是无法直接利用的,直接转义也无法利用。下面,我把实现方式演示一些,趁便也把整个测试过程写写,大师一路来拓睁开发思维。

东西/原料

  • 电脑 VS开辟软件

方式/步调

  1. 1

    先描述下这个测试方案,我是为了达到在规格前面加上暗示直径的符号 φ。

  2. 2

    最初的设法,在暗示直径的代码前面直接加上符号 φ,我们来加上尝尝看。

     string spc1;

        if (textBox5.Text == "立方体")

                    {

                        spc1 = textBox9.Text + " * " + textBox10.Text + " * " + textBox4.Text;

                    }

                    else

                    {

                        spc1 ="φ"+" " + 2 * double.Parse(textBox4.Text) + " * " + textBox9.Text;

     

                    }

  3. 3

    换一种思绪,想想这些是特别字符,那么我们考虑用转义来实现。直接转会报错,最初考虑到用加双引号来实现。

     spc1 ="\"φ"+" " + 2 * double.Parse(textBox4.Text) + " * " + textBox9.Text;

  4. 4

    既然转义是解决问题的偏向,那么,我们来看看C#中的一些关于转义的界说。

  5. 5

    在第三步的根本上,我们想想,是否能把双引号用一个空的字符来取代,所以就测验考试利用 \0转义为空来尝尝看。

     spc1 ="\0φ"+" " + 2 * double.Parse(textBox4.Text) + " * " + textBox9.Text;

  6. 6

    建议,在代码编写过程中,要不竭去思虑,并斗胆去验证。其实,编程就是把看似不成能实现的功能实现,只要逻辑存在,功能就必然能实现。

注重事项

  • 铺开思维去想,而且脱手去测试。
  • 发表于 2018-05-06 00:00
  • 阅读 ( 1664 )
  • 分类:其他类型

你可能感兴趣的文章

相关问题

0 条评论

请先 登录 后评论
admin
admin

0 篇文章

作家榜 »

  1. xiaonan123 189 文章
  2. 汤依妹儿 97 文章
  3. luogf229 46 文章
  4. jy02406749 45 文章
  5. 小凡 34 文章
  6. Daisy萌 32 文章
  7. 我的QQ3117863681 24 文章
  8. 华志健 23 文章

联系我们:uytrv@hotmail.com 问答工具